There are a variety of leathers that can be used to cover a chesterfield couch each with their own distinct characteristics. Pigmented leather is distinguished by smooth surface texture, durability and a polymer-based coating that is infused with pigments. This type of leather is available in various styles such as plain, embossed, and printed.
The tanning process gives aniline leather an incredibly natural, soft appearance. This leather is used for furniture because it's flexible and can be stretched into a variety of shapes without compromising the structural strength. However, since it doesn't have a protective layer on the surface, aniline leather will exhibit wear and tear easily.
Semi-aniline leather is a compromise that provides greater durability than leather that is pigmented and still has a lot of the natural look and feel of aniline leather. It has a very low pigment surface coating which can be lightly embossed for visual and texture. However it isn't able to stretch nearly as much as aniline.

When shopping for a chesterfield look for quality materials that will endure the rigors of daily use.
If taken care of properly the chesterfield that is made of top quality leather will have a natural appearance that lasts for a long time. Select a sofa constructed of a solid, genuine hide to ensure its durability. Avoid imitation leather, as it is difficult to clean and is more vulnerable to staining. If you're purchasing a chesterfield that's already made choose a premium frame made of seasoned beech wood with chunky rails that can support the weight of a massive sofa.
If you're looking for a chesterfield chair, ensure that it has sufficient cushion filling. This will give you an enjoyable and comfortable experience. Foam is a well-liked option however feathers and polyester fibres can be used in combination to create hybrid cushioning. You should also check whether the filling is attached to the frame with a hand so that it won't shift or deflate over time.
Another crucial aspect of a quality chesterfield is the suspension system. Sofas that are less expensive will typically have a less robust spring or webbing which is more likely to fail over time. However, a chesterfield made well should have webbing that's secured by corner blocks that are screw-fixed and is able to provide plenty of spring action.
The leather's finish can also impact the overall look and feel of the sofa. The leather that is pigmented has a high level of durability, whereas semi-aniline leather offers the improved durability of pigmented leather with more of the natural appearance of aniline.

A high-quality Chesterfield leather corner sofa is durable and will last for many years. It should be simple to tell the difference between a real Chesterfield and a cheaper knockoff that won't stand the test of time. A frame made of quality materials is the first thing you need to look for. Cheaper materials like particleboard and MDF will not be sturdy enough to support the weight of the Chesterfield frame, which means that the frame will begin to bend under pressure.
Another important sign of a real Chesterfield is the depth and quality of the cushion filling. The frame must be hidden under the cushioning. If you choose to use foam, it should be dense, high-quality material. A high-quality Chesterfield can blend various densities into an enveloping that is soft and comfortable.
The suspension system of a Chesterfield should also be of good quality. Less expensive models use springs that are coiled or inferior webbing, which can be prone to failure under stress. A top-quality suspension will be a combination of sprung and webbing parts, which provide a great balance of comfort and endurance.
The quality of the Chesterfield's design is also crucial. Quality pieces will apply the buttoning deep into the sofa, giving it a unique appearance and keeps it together. Less expensive pieces will not bother with this detail. The studs on a high-end Chesterfield will be individually hammered into place, whereas mass-produced couches will simply have buttons inserted into the cushions and stuck to the frame.

Maintenance
A chesterfield corner sofa is a grand feature for any home decor. To keep the appearance of the leather, it is crucial to take care. Regular cleaning and dusting will help extend the longevity of your sofa. Regular inspections will allow you to identify issues and address them before they become more serious.
Leather is very sensitive to moisture. It is therefore important to keep leather well-hydrated and moisturized by with a quality leather conditioner or protector. This will stop cracks and sagging. Make sure the sofa is away from direct sunlight and heat sources. Heat and light can dry out the leather which causes it to stiffen and crack.

Spills, Spots and Stains
Unintentional spills on a leather sofa can cause serious damage, particularly if they are not cleaned up immediately. Be sure to use a dry cloth to blot any liquid spills as quickly as possible to avoid the staining effects of water and other harmful chemicals on leather. Ink spills are especially damaging and should be treated immediately. Using a protection cream on your leather will shield it from the effects of staining and will also repel general water-based and oil-based staining, making them easier to clean.
Regularly vacuum your leather sofa with a soft brush attachment. This will remove dirt, dust and other debris that can ruin the appearance of your Chesterfield. It will also eliminate any loose fibers that may have been accumulating in corners or crevices. This is a simple method to keep your Chesterfield looking new and fresh.
You can apply a leather cream or spray on your sofa to protect it from marks and stains. This is particularly helpful for aniline, semi-aniline, and pigmented leathers since it adds an additional layer of protection to the surface of your leather preventing it from being damaged by spillages and other staining.
